Drugs smuggling case: Mumbai Police team to take custody of suspect lodged in Bihar's Motihari jail

A team of Anti-Narcotics Cell of Mumbai Police's Crime Branch sought custody of Vijay Bansiprasad Yadav, who is lodged at Motihari Central Jail in Bihar.

Mumbai Police said that Prasad, a resident of Mumbai, will be brought back to the city after police custody is granted. The team of the Anti-Narcotics Cell has been stationed in Bihar for the last 10 days and is conducting an investigation.
